Frequently asked questions
Does the Point-Lok offer universal needle compatibility?
Yes, the Point-Lok Universal Needle Protection Device provides universal compatibility for securing contaminated needles that do not feature integral Engineered Sharps Injury Protection (ESIP).
This device is engineered as a robust, stand-alone measure to enhance clinical safety:
- Broad Gauge Range: It effectively secures and protects needles across a wide size spectrum, specifically from 16 gauge (G) up to 30 gauge (G).
- Secure Locking Mechanism: Designed to firmly lock onto the used needle after a procedure, significantly mitigating the risk of accidental needlestick injuries.
- Regulatory Compliance: The Point-Lok adheres to the Federal Register definition of an Engineering Control, confirming its role as a key component in maintaining sharps safety standards.

Is the Point-Lok device available standalone or included in kits?
Yes, the Point-Lok device is designed for versatile integration and is available both as a stand-alone item and pre-packaged in procedural trays. This critical safety device meets the definition of an Engineering Control for sharps protection.
Availability Options:
- Integrated into Kits: The Point-Lok is included in various specialized procedural trays, such as:
- Portex Arterial Blood Sampling kits
- Pain management trays
- Stand-alone Configurations: It can be purchased separately in bulk for use with contaminated needles ranging from 16G to 30G. Available options include:
- Stylets, 100/bg, 10 bg/cs (Manufacturer Part Number: 4139)
- Stylets, Non-Sterile, 1000/bx, 3 bx/cs
